// ScaleImageNearestNeighbor scales an image using the nearest neighbor method.
|
||||
// This method is extremely inefficient, but at the small scaling values we are using the performance hit is almost immeasurable.
|
||||
func ScaleImageNearestNeighbor(img image.Image, sx, sy int) image.Image {
|
||||
s := img.Bounds().Size()
|
||||
|
||||
out := image.NewRGBA(image.Rect(0, 0, s.X*sx, s.Y*sy))
|
||||
|
||||
for ix := 0; ix < s.X; ix++ {
|
||||
for iy := 0; iy < s.Y; iy++ {
|
||||
c := img.At(ix, iy)
|
||||
|
||||
for ox := 0; ox < sx; ox++ {
|
||||
for oy := 0; oy < sy; oy++ {
|
||||
out.Set(ix*sx+ox, iy*sy+oy, c)
|
||||
}
|
||||
}
|
||||
}
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
return out
|
||||
}
